Understanding Agrilife Free Childcare Training
Agrilife Free Childcare Training is part of a broader initiative by Texas A&M AgriLife to support community development and improve the quality of life for families. This program is designed to provide free, accessible training resources for individuals interested in pursuing a career in childcare or enhancing their existing skills.
Objectives of the Program
The primary objectives of the Agrilife Free Childcare Training include:
1. Enhancing Childcare Skills: Providing participants with the knowledge and skills needed to care for children effectively.
2. Promoting Child Development: Educating caregivers on the stages of child development and the importance of age-appropriate activities.
3. Fostering Safe Environments: Training on how to create safe, nurturing environments for children.
4. Supporting Families: Assisting families by ensuring they have access to qualified childcare providers.
Curriculum Overview
The curriculum for Agrilife Free Childcare Training is comprehensive and covers a wide range of topics essential for effective childcare.
Key Areas of Focus
1. Child Development:
- Understanding developmental milestones.
- Recognizing the emotional, social, and cognitive needs of children.
2. Health and Safety:
- Basic first aid and CPR training.
- Nutrition and healthy eating habits for children.
- Creating a safe play environment to prevent accidents.
3. Behavior Management:
- Techniques for positive discipline.
- Understanding child behavior and how to address common issues.
4. Educational Activities:
- Planning and implementing age-appropriate learning activities.
- Incorporating play into learning to stimulate development.
5. Communication Skills:
- Effective communication with children and parents.
- Cultural sensitivity and inclusion in childcare practices.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Agrilife Free Childcare Training?
Agrilife Free Childcare Training is a program designed to provide training and resources for individuals interested in improving their childcare skills and knowledge, particularly in agricultural communities.
Who is eligible to participate in Agrilife Free Childcare Training?
The training is typically open to parents, caregivers, and childcare providers within agricultural communities, but specific eligibility may vary by program location.
What topics are covered in the Agrilife Free Childcare Training program?
Topics often include child development, health and safety practices, nutrition, and strategies for engaging children in educational activities related to agriculture.
Is there a cost associated with Agrilife Free Childcare Training?
No, as the program is designed to be free of charge to ensure accessibility for all eligible participants.
How can I enroll in Agrilife Free Childcare Training?
Enrollment typically involves registering through local Agrilife Extension offices or their websites, where participants can find details about upcoming training sessions.
Are there any certifications provided upon completion of the training?
Yes, participants usually receive a certificate of completion, which can be beneficial for those seeking employment in childcare roles.
